在当今的网络环境中,Clash作为一款强大的网络代理工具,已被越来越多的人所使用。而其中的yaml文件,让整个配置过程更加灵活和高效。本文将详细探讨yaml在Clash哪个文件夹下,帮助用户快速找到和理解配置文件的重要性。
什么是yaml文件
在深入了解yaml在Clash中的文件夹路径之前,我们首先要了解什么是yaml文件。
- YAML(YAML Ain’t Markup Language)是一种简洁的数据序列化格式,常用于配置文件。
- 其语法简单、可读性高,非常适合人类阅读和编辑。
- yaml文件在许多现代应用程序中得到广泛使用,Clash当然不例外。
Clash的工作原理
Clash是一款以透明代理为目标,通过配置文件控制代理规则和互联配置的一款工具。在Clash中,yaml文件用来定义许多核心设置,如代理服务器、规则集、API等。
为什么要使用yaml文件
- 灵活配置:用户可以根据需要自由修改配置。
- 高可读性:比起其他格式的配置文件,yaml的可读性更强。
- 支持多种格式:能够处理列表与字典等多种数据结构。
Clash中yaml文件的存放路径
在使用Clash的时候,用户需了解yaml文件的具体存放路径。Clash通常在以下文件夹中寻找yaml文件:
-
主配置文件夹:用户可以在以下路径下找到主配置文件,例如:
- Windows:
%userprofile%\.config\clash\config.yaml
- macOS/Linux:
~/.config/clash/config.yaml
- Windows:
-
层叠配置:在一个合成配置中,其他重要的配置文件可能存储在下列路径下:
- 代理配置文件:在主配置的同级目录下,files文件夹,用于存放不同的代理yaml配置。
- 规则文件
%userprofile%\.config\clash\rules.yaml
~/.config/clash/rules.yaml
如何配置yaml文件
正确配置yaml文件,将直接影响Clash的运行效果。以下是进行简单配置过程中需遵循的一些步骤:
1. 打开yaml文件
使用文本编辑器打开上述路径中的config.yaml
文件。
2. 编辑配置内容
- 代理部分:添加或修改你所用的代理服务器,确保格式正确。
- 规则部分:根据需要配置不同的规则,如通过规则基、GeoIP等方式进行设定。
3. 保存文件
在完成编辑后,保存文件并重启Clash。
FAQ
1. 如何查找yaml文件夹的具体路径?
- 在Windows系统中,可以通过文件资源管理器,在地址栏输入
%userprofile%\.config\clash\
找到该路径。 - 对于macOS/Linux用户,可以打开终端,使用命令
cd ~/.config/clash/
进入文件夹。
2. yaml文件可以于其他地方存储吗?
- 可以,Clash允许用户自定义配置文件的路径,但一定要在程序中进行对应调整。
3. 改动yaml文件后如何使更改生效?
- 必须保存更改并重启Clash才能使新配置生效。
4. yaml文件出现错误会怎样?
- 如果yaml文件格式错误,Clash会在启动之后报错,用户需要校对和修正错误后重新运行。
结论
综上所述,了解yaml在Clash哪个文件夹下是每个用户使用Clash等网络工具的重要基础。只有掌握旗舰的使用效应,定期审视和调整相应的配置,才能获得更优的网络体验。今后,内容中的路径、高级设置及个性化选项,可以帮助用户灵活配置其网络环境,确保安全有效的上网体验。
正文完